Save Comment 41 Like Natural wood is a lovely rimber for adding warmth and texture to garden structures like raised beds, fences, decks and trellises.

Much lumber is chemically treated to prevent it from rotting. However, some woods have superior rot resistance naturally and can be used outdoors without chemical treatment. Back in the day, farmers used local trees to create rot-resistant fences at their property line. In New England, black locust Robinia pseudoacacia was the preferred tree.

Midwest farmers planted thorny Osage orange Maclura pomifera to delineate their property lines and keep farm animals contained.

Sometimes they used living stakes and let them grow into a living fence-hedge. Both black locust and Osage orange can be seen growing as hedgerows in these regions today. Those farmers had the right idea to use naturally rot-resistant wood to create low-maintenance fences. It was a locally available building material that required little maintenance. Source wood that is naturally rot resistant and local to create gorgeous natural surfaces in your garden.

Twining-type vines that wrap around structures, like clematis, are a better choice for a rot-resistant wood trellis, because they will not try to attach their roots to the wood. Raised beds. Resting raised cedar beds on gravel instead of soil is a smart move, because the gravel will drain water quickly away from 8 foot landscaping timber up cedar and does not retain moisture.

For the interior of a raised bed, a geotextile or landscape fabric can separate the bedding soil from the wood to wick moisture away from the wood and preserve its longevity. Wood can 8 foot landscaping timber up come under attack by insects, fungi and other organisms. Using rot-resistant wood outside is especially important when the wood comes in direct contact with the ground, like with a raised garden bed or vine trellis.

Ground contact opens the wood up to mold and fungus because it allows moisture to penetrate the wood, which expands and splits in response. There are methods of construction for avoiding ground contact and for pitching wood so that water does not collect on the surface. Plants and vines that grow over the wood also accelerate rot due to moisture buildup.
